Some awful news just broke for Fighting Illini football. Via his Twitter account, freshman running back Dre Brown has suffered another torn ACL and will miss the 2016 season. Brown was the victim of a similar injury to his other knee last Spring (almost a year ago today, actually).

Brown, a former three-star recruit, was expected to be competing for playing time behind sophomore Ke'Shawn Vaughn this season.

Of course, star wide receiver Mikey Dudek also suffered a second consecutive season-ending knee injury about two weeks ago. The two incidents aren't necessarily related, but it's hard to ignore the somewhat alarming number of injuries that Illinois has suffered in recent offseasons.
